Reasons to consider the AMD Athlon II X2 270

  • CPU is newer: launch date 5 year(s) 2 month(s) later
  • Around 55% higher clock speed: 3.4 GHz vs 2.2 GHz
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running processor: 45 nm vs 90 nm
  • Around 79% better performance in PassMark - Single thread mark: 1363 vs 763
  • Around 96% better performance in PassMark - CPU mark: 1316 vs 671

Reasons to consider the AMD Athlon 64 X2 4400+ EE

  • 2x more L1 cache, more data can be stored in the L1 cache for quick access later
  • 2.6x better performance in Geekbench 4 - Single Core: 1044 vs 396
  • 2.3x better performance in Geekbench 4 - Multi-Core: 1731 vs 737
